#2648ed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2648ed is composed of 14.9% red, 28.2% green and 92.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84% cyan, 69.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 229.7 degrees, a saturation of 84.7% and a lightness of 53.9%. #2648ed color hex could be obtained by blending #4c90ff with #0000db. Closest websafe color is: #3333ff.

#2648ed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2648ed has RGB values of R:38, G:72, B:237 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:0.7, Y:0, K:0.07. Its decimal value is 2509037.
